History

The luxury clothing store was started in 1975, by Marilyn Rubinson, in Brooklyn New York. By the early 2000s, the company had over 200 stores, in different malls across the country, including King Of Prussia Mall, Beachwood Mall, and
Southern Park Mall Southern Park is a shopping mall in Boardman, Ohio, United States, serving the Mahoning Valley, Youngstown–Warren metropolitan area. It was developed by the Edward J. DeBartolo, Sr., Edward J. DeBartolo Corporation in 1970, and is now owned by ...
. The company failed to turn profits in 2011. In 2013, despite financial troubles, Caché opened a new flagship store located in The Fashion Show Mall, on the
Las Vegas Strip The Las Vegas Strip is a stretch of Las Vegas Boulevard in Clark County, Nevada, that is known for its concentration of resort hotels and casinos. The Strip, as it is known, is about long, and is immediately south of the Las Vegas city limits ...
. In 2015, the company filed for Chapter 11 Bankruptcy protection, and announced they would be liquidating (permanently closing) all stores, including the newly opened flagship store.
